LX-LL-LF (Lin Xian-Liu Lin-Lin Fen) CBM (Coal Bed Methane) pipeline starting at Lin Xian in Lvliang City and end at Lin Fen in Yaodu District of Shanxi Province. According to national regulations, all construction projects must have a project feasibility analysis, in order to guarantee the right investment decisions.Firstly, this paper analyzed the gas source, qualities and some other features of CBM, and had a market analysis and forecasting that Lin Xian-Liu Lin-Lin Fen CBM natural gas pipeline to provide reliable resources for the downstream market depending on the supply situation and social conditions. Secondly, we analyzed the Lin Xian-Liu Lin-Lin Fen CBM Pipeline project overview, including selection of gas transmission line design, line pipe and gas station technology and equipment. Meanwhile, paper compared and determined the appropriate technical solutions about gas pipeline alignments, profiles natural wear over the situation, regional scale factor, line valve chamber, hydraulic protection and sand-fixing measures. Considering the economy, reliability of investment pipeline running, we had a comprehensive technical and economic comparison between different plans, and determined the public works program. According to the engineering design of the main process parameters, the transportation technology program system was determined, and the selected file was calculated and analyzed. Gas output and gas peaking were also calculated and predicted.Finally, based on the results of process analysis, automatic control and communications and public works, and combined with the actual situation analysis of the project investment, financing, production costs, operating income and operating profit,we determined the critical point of the breakeven annual production capacity utilization the rate. The overall plan, which has investment 2,898,124,000 yuan, including construction period interest 42,728,100 yuan, the project cost of 1,035,945,000 yuan, is feasible.
